Can't really switch sides on summer tires either unless you dismount and remount them in the when you switch sides. Summer tires are typically directional so simply swapping side without dismounting/remounting them means the tread will be in reverse rotation. Bad for tire wear and bad for traction.

A lot of members have two sets of tires for driving their vehicle year round in regions where four seasons exist (summer and all season/winter). You should absolutely not drive summer tires in freezing temps. It will crack the compounds in the tire and ruin the tire. The cracking will look like dry rot. Some tire mfg's have disclaimers for that and also void warranty's for that type of damage. You also lose considerable traction with a summer tire in freezing temps. Its like trying to take a hard plastic wheel and gaining traction on a hard surface.

i changed my order. i am now getting the performance pkg. so i need to sort the tire issue as i need all season.

the dealer cant help except to sell me new tires at cost. i called about a trade in program at discount tire and he told me to call michelin. all the pics i am seeing have michelins on the performance pkg.

so i called them and they said they would trade out via an even swap for all seasons! that was easy. they created a case for me and said to just call back once i have the car. and to keep the tire under 1000 miles and that way they will do a warranty swap.
